Ohio transplant living in New York City but still making movies in Ohio (and New York City).
Bryan Enk has been making movies since 1992. His feature credits as director include Midnight Days (2000), Macbeth (2003), The Big Bad (2011), The Passion of Paul Ross (2017), and Blood Daughter (2022). He produced the horror feature The Horror at Gallery Kay (2018), directed by Abe Goldfarb, and co-produced and co-directed The Moose Head Over the Mantel (2017), which is currently available on Blu-ray, DVD and digital via Gravitas Ventures. His short films include The Eleventh Waitress (2025), Beneath the Sea It Sings (2025), and Pentagram Girl (2024).
